Most of the problems that poor and marginalised people are facing in Central America have structural causes.
DanChurchAid is not only focusing on providing help for the most immediate needs, but also on strengthening civil society’s capacity to influence political processes and power structures.
DanChurchAid supports its partners' political advocacy work towards the governments and is also working on the international level.
At the European level, DanChurchAid participates in European NGO networks pressuring the European governments to take responsibility for agricultural policies as well as trade and aid policies affecting the populations in Central America. This is mainly done through the European network PICA.
DanChurchAid cooperates with European sister organisations within the Association of Protestant Development organisations, APRODEV , as well as the Copenhagen Initiative for Central America, CIFCA , in both cases mainly in relation to advocacy on Central American issues directed at European institutions and governments.
